考虑时序约束的多智能体协同任务分配

DOI: 10.13195/j.kzyjc.2014.1114, PP. 1999-2003

Keywords: 一致性包算法,分布式任务分配,多智能体系统,时序约束

Full-Text   Cite this paper   Add to My Lib

Abstract:

研究多智能体系统的多目标多任务分配问题,考虑任务之间的时序关系,建立分布式任务分配模型.扩展了一致性包算法(CBBA),按优先级将目标任务归入不同层级,各智能体在构建任务包和任务路径时,只将分配过高阶段任务的目标添加至相应的任务包和任务路径中,从而保证目标任务时序约束的同时,保持了CBBA算法的特性.与多任务分配问题经典算法的比对实验表明,所提出的改进算法求解结果稳定可靠,运行时间优于经典算法.
